Vehicle alert system

The Vehicle Alert System has an RF transmitter system which is activated by a steering wheel switch which in turn signals matching receivers in other nearby vehicles. Upon activation, multiple receivers on other so equipped vehicles will detect the originating direction of the alert. A single board computer (SBC) will then activate a respective speaker on the interior of the receiving vehicle to indicate the direction of the alert. A dash mounted panel with LED indicators may also be provided. The device is also capable of disabling any audio entertainment systems in the receiving vehicle thereby ensuring that the warning signal is heard. A bright front mounted purple light would alert pedestrians to potential danger.

Method for displaying safety-relevant information on a display device of a vehicle
11292339 · 2022-04-05 · ·

The disclosure relates to a method for displaying safety-relevant information on a display device of a vehicle. A speed of the vehicle, environment data representing an environment of the vehicle, a driver reaction time, and an emergency braking reaction time for an emergency braking driver assistance function are input, and used to superimpose an emergency braking marker and a driver intervention marker on the map representing a lane in which the vehicle is travelling in the display device. The emergency braking marker represents a future point in time and/or future location for an intervention of the emergency braking driver assistance function, and the driver intervention marker represents a future point in time and/or a future location for the latest possible intervention of the driver prior to the intervention of the emergency braking driver assistance function.

Apparatus and method for providing user interface for platooning in vehicle

An apparatus for providing a user interface for platooning in a vehicle is provided. The apparatus includes a touch screen display, a communication circuit that communicates with the outside, and a control circuit electrically connected with the touch screen display and the communication circuit. The control circuit displays a first object corresponding to the vehicle and a second object corresponding to an outside vehicle included in a platooning group on the touch screen display and receives a touch input associated with the first object and the second object using the touch screen display. The vehicle is thus operated to adjust a distance between the vehicle and the outside vehicle in response to the touch input.

Condition-based determination and indication of remaining energy range for vehicles

Systems and methods for determining and indicating an energy range of a host vehicle. A sensor can be positioned to acquire data corresponding to an amount of energy stored in an energy storage system of the host vehicle. An anticipated operating condition for a forthcoming location of the host vehicle can be determined based on at least one operating condition provided from at least one of a plurality of vehicles that 1) has a vehicle type that is the same as a vehicle type of the host vehicle and 2) is located at a respective location that is proximate to the forthcoming location of the host vehicle. The remaining energy range can be determined based on 1) the amount of energy stored in the energy storage system and 2) the anticipated operating condition, and an output system of the host vehicle can indicate the remaining energy range for the host vehicle.
